Why a Pole + Baffle Setup Is a Game Changer
Bird lovers often struggle with squirrels raiding feeders. A bird feeder mounted on a pole with a squirrel baffle offers a smart, humane way to protect your bird food and keep squirrels at bay.
- Physical barrier: The baffle blocks squirrels from climbing past, either because of its smooth shape, overhang, or wobble design.
- Elevated design: Raising the feeder gives birds an unobstructed view and makes it harder for predators or pests to reach.
- Cleaner feeding area: Less spilled seed on the ground means fewer rodents or unwanted guests.
- Durability & aesthetics: Good poles are made of powder‑coated steel or galvanized materials and look elegant in garden settings.
As Homes & Gardens notes, the correct placement—at least 4 feet above ground and 8–10 feet away from jump-off points—is essential for effectiveness. Homes and Gardens

Safety & Setup Tips
To help customers get the best results—and avoid frustration—include a “Tips & Best Practices” section. For example:
- Distance matters
Place your pole at least 8–10 feet away from trees, fences, roofs, or anything a squirrel might leap from. Birdseed & Binoculars+1 - Correct baffle height
The baffle should ideally be 4 feet or more above the ground, and below the feeder height so squirrels can’t reach the feeder from the top. - Use a smooth, overhanging design
Sloped or smooth surfaces prevent squirrels from gaining traction. - Spring or wobble motion helps
Some baffles move or tilt when touched, making it hard for squirrels to climb. The Squirrel Stopper line uses this idea. Amazon - Install securely
Use augers, strong joints, and ensure the pole is firmly anchored so wind or weight doesn’t shift it. - Periodically check alignment
Over time, feeders or baffles might shift; ensure nothing allows access paths for squirrels. - Clean regularly
A clean feeder reduces mold, moisture, and seed spoilage. Also keep the baffle free of debris.
